A full roofing system has numerous different products, each with their own objective in keeping your roofing system secure from leaks and various other damage.


Your roof decking is the base layer of your roofing system. It's assembled of multiple boards that are either plywood, or oriented hair boards (OSB), and function as the link between your roofing materials and the framework of your home. The decking (often also called sheathing) is toenailed or stapled into the building's rafters, and roof covering products are set up in addition to it.

The products that we'll be looking at are underlayment, ice/water shield, and flashing. Underlayment is a waterproof layer, typically presented and toenailed down straight onto the roof outdoor decking before various other roof covering products. The underlayment is really the last line of protection that your outdoor decking has, and offers to safeguard it from water making it through any small scrapes and holes in your top layer of roof shingles, particularly as a result of wind-driven rainfall.

Ice/water shield is basically a beefed-up underlayment, with rubberized asphalt and an adhesive that enables it to be turned out secured without penetrating the surface area with nails or staples. This product is most regularly made use of in areas that are very sensitive to leakages, and where water spends a great deal of time.

There are several types of roof covering vents, whether it be roof louvers ridge vents, or wind generators. Each are developed to allow warm air out of your roof, and maintain the temperature and humidity below it controlled.
